0.5 as a fraction in lowest term

Mathematics
2 answers:
lyudmila [28]3 years ago
5 0

To turn 0.5 into a fraction, first notice that there is only 1 number after the decimal point and the 5 in 0.5 is in the tenths place. The 5 in the tenths place can represent \frac{5}{10}. We can reduce the fraction to \frac{1}{2} by dividing both the numerator and the denominator by 2.
